Dubious/Harsh? North Essex Parking Partnership Ticket

Fightback_Jack
Posts: 28 Forumite
The brief story.... I received a ticket from North Essex Parking Partnership "code 02 Parking in a loading bay"
I have parked my motorbike on a town square alongside others and the bicycles for the over 10 years the exact same spot no problems or issues. (over 20 feet from the actual road) to satisfy my own paranoia I have asked before and it was confirmed to be ok by a traffic warden.
I parked my bike next to 2 mopeds, went to the bank but it was already shut I returned to a ticket not even 6 min later as if the guy watched me get off an done the ticket instantaneously no grace period given (not sure if NEPP has one...?) The 2 mopeds next to me had no ticket....enraged and shocked I dashed around to find the Warden, 1st one i found even said "I saw your bike sitting there thought to myself it looked good" then was surprised when I told him I got a ticket as he didnt see a problem with where it was!
I eventually found the Warden who gave me the ticket, he said he done it as in his opinion I was not close enough to the other bicycles, when I said "why didnt the mopeds get tickets" His reply was "I thought they were close enough" when I tried telling him he was giving me a ticket based on his opinion he pointed out some very faded almost non existent lines coming off the kerb and onto the double yellow lines apparently meaning the yellow lines are enforced all the way to the nearest building.
"but if you were a little closer i wouldnt have done it" where his final words
This is why I got a "02 parked in a loading bay"...Obviously its not a actual loading bay.... I was off road by 20 feet parked out of the way on a square where people eat, park bikes/motorbikes and drink cheap lager till they fight or harass others.
Theres no actual markings next to the bike racks, or signs stating its not aloud and as we talked more bikes pulled up there....
I had no idea what these faded lines meant.
The lines are not visible coming off the kerbs (almost non existent) for over ten meters. But also you can get onto the town square where the bike was parked without going up the kerbs where there are yellow kerb lines. He just pointed to the ones nearest my bike.
I have appealed within the 14 day limit, as I had no idea about this place.
Can I use this evidence or anything else after I get my response back from them?
BIGGG thanks in Advance !!

Defo Council. NEPP are wholly-owned by Colchester Borough Council & operate parking services on behalf of Colhester, Braintree & Tendring Councils.
First off, go back and check the FULL LENGTH of the double yellow lines. Are there any breaks *even to one line)?. If 'Yes' then the lines are unenforceable as they do not comply with legislation (you can find some good legal advice about this via google).
Also, try to find-out if the Council actually own the land you were parked on.
